Signal specification, audio control module
Connecting the breakout box and
checking the ground terminal
Caution! Before taking readings, the breakout
box must be connected and the ground terminal
must be checked. See Checking the ground
terminals .
Definitions
DC voltage in volts (V) Ulow = Voltage near 0 V
Ubat = Battery voltage
The audio control module, green connector
Note! The connectors on the adapter cable must
be correctly colored to correspond to the signal
table.
Before taking any readings, see Connecting the
breakout box and checking the ground terminal .
Control
module
terminal
Breakout
box
terminal
Signal type Ignition on Other
A1 #15 30 supply Ubat -
A2 #16 15 supply Ubat -
A3 #17 - - -
A4 #18 - - -
A5 #19 - - -
A6 #20 - - -
A7 #21 CANH Digital signal 2-3 V -
A8 #22 CANL Digital signal 2-3 V -
A9 #23 Power supply, aerial
amplifier
11 V -
A10 #24 Audio channel (+),
centre loudspeaker
Alternating current at
sound in centre
loudspeaker
-
A11 #25 Audio channel (-), centre
loudspeaker
Alternating current at
sound in centre
loudspeaker
-
A12 #26 Ground Ulow -

Signal specification, RTI
Connecting the breakout box and
checking the ground terminal
G4
G5
Note! Before taking readings, the breakout box
must be connected and the ground terminal
must be checked. See Checking the ground
terminals .
Definitions
DC voltage in volts (V) Ulow = Ground, shield ground
Ubat = Battery voltage
RTI control module
Before taking any readings, read Connecting the
breakout box and checking the ground terminal .
The road and traffic information (RTI) control
module terminals D1-D5 correspond to
terminals #22-#26 on the breakout box.
Control
module
terminal
Breakout
box
terminal
Signal type Ignition on Other
D1 #22 30-supply (power supply
from battery)
U
bat
-
D2 #23 - - -
D3 #24 CANH signal U=2.5-4.0 V -
D4 #25 CANL signal U=1.0-2.5 V -
D5 #26 Ground (Measured to
battery negative terminal)
U
low
-

RTI control module (to display)
Before taking any readings, read Connecting the
breakout box and checking the ground terminal .
The RTI control module terminals C1-C10
correspond to terminals #1-#10 on the
breakout box.
Control
module
terminal
Breakout
box
terminal
Signal type Ignition on Other
C1 #1 Color signal (red), screen Analog signal when red
color is displayed
0.714 V p-p
C2 #2 Color signal (green),
display
Analog signal when
green color is displayed
0.714 V p-p
C3 #3 - - -
C4 #4 Serial bus to the display Digital signal Half duplex, start-
stop synchronizer,
2400 bps
C5 #5 Signal, remote control for
the display screen
Digital signal 38 kHz carrier wave
when the remote
control is pressed
C6 #6 Color signal (blue),
screen
Analog signal when blue
color is displayed
0.714 V p-p
C7 #7 Screen ground, video Ulow -
"VCC-137581 EN 2006-10-26"
6
signals
C8 #8 Composite sync, display
screen
Analog signal 0-5 V
C9 #9 - - -
C10 #10 Video signal to display Analog signal 1 V p-p +/- 0.2 V

RTI control module (to audio unit)
Before taking any readings, read Connecting the
breakout box and checking the ground terminal .
The RTI control module terminals E1-E8
correspond to terminal #16-#23 on the
breakout box.
Control
module
terminal
Breakout
box
terminal
Signal type Ignition on Other
E1 #16 Clock signal to audio unit Digital signal Melbus protocol
E2 #17 Signal ground, sound Ulow -
E3 #18 15 supply Ubat -
E4 #19 Data signal to audio unit Digital signal Melbus protocol
E5 #20 Busy signal to audio unit Digital signal Melbus protocol
E6 #21 Left audio channel Alternating current on
sound to loudspeakers
150 mV rms +/-
38 mV
(1 kHz 30% mod)
E7 #22 Right audio channel Alternating current on
sound to loudspeakers
150 mV rms +/-
38 mV
(1 kHz 30% mod)
E8 #23 Voice guide channel Alternating current on
sound to loudspeakers
(for voice guidance)
150 mV rms +/-
38 mV
(1 kHz 30% mod)
H Screen ground, cable to
audio unit
Ulow -
